Statutory records play a vital role in ensuring effective and efficient management of Nigerian schools. These records serve as a repository of essential information and provide a framework for accountability and compliance. In this article, we will explore different statutory records commonly maintained in Nigerian schools, their uses, and why they are important for the smooth functioning of educational institutions.

  1. Attendance Records:
    Attendance records document the presence or absence of students and staff members. They are crucial for tracking attendance patterns, monitoring punctuality, and ensuring compliance with educational regulations. These records provide valuable data for identifying trends, addressing truancy issues, and assessing overall school performance.
  2. Admission and Enrollment Records:
    Admission and enrollment records capture information about students’ personal details, contact information, previous schools attended, and academic history. These records aid in the efficient management of student enrollment, facilitate effective communication with parents, and assist in planning for the allocation of resources and facilities.
  3. Academic Records:
    Academic records include individual student transcripts, report cards, and examination results. They serve as a comprehensive record of a student’s academic journey, documenting their progress, achievements, and areas for improvement. Academic records are crucial for tracking student performance, identifying learning gaps, and providing necessary support and interventions.
  4. Staff Records:
    Staff records maintain essential information about school personnel, including employment contracts, qualifications, training records, and performance evaluations. These records ensure compliance with labor laws, support human resource management, and aid in the identification of staff development needs.
  5. Financial Records:
    Financial records document all financial transactions within the school, including budgets, income, expenditures, and audits. These records are critical for financial management, ensuring transparency, and accountability. They provide insights into the financial health of the school, aid in decision-making processes, and facilitate compliance with financial regulations.
  6. Health and Medical Records:
    Health and medical records maintain relevant health information of students, including immunization records, medical conditions, and emergency contact details. These records support the provision of appropriate healthcare, facilitate timely interventions during emergencies, and ensure the overall well-being and safety of students.

Importance of Statutory Records in Nigerian Schools:

a) Compliance and Accountability: Statutory records help schools comply with educational laws, policies, and regulations. They enable schools to provide accurate and up-to-date information when required by regulatory bodies, ensuring accountability and avoiding potential legal issues.

b) Decision-making and Planning: These records provide valuable data for informed decision-making and strategic planning. They assist in identifying trends, evaluating program effectiveness, and allocating resources efficiently, ultimately enhancing the quality of education provided.

c) Continuous Improvement: Statutory records contribute to continuous improvement by enabling schools to monitor and assess their performance. They aid in identifying areas of strength and weakness, implementing targeted interventions, and tracking progress over time.

d) Effective Communication: These records support effective communication with parents, stakeholders, and educational authorities. They ensure clear and transparent information exchange, enabling parents to stay informed about their child’s progress and fostering a collaborative school-home partnership.

e) Historical Reference: Statutory records serve as historical references for schools, providing a documented account of the institution’s journey, achievements, and milestones. They contribute to the preservation of institutional memory and support long-term planning and development.
